March 2

One of my favorite author's had his birthday on March 2nd. Dr. Seuss was a great author! He did so much for children's literature. Who doesn't remember-- Hop on Pop; Red fish, Blue fish; Green Eggs and Ham; Horton Hears a Who;The Cat in the Hat; and many more wonderful rhyming stories with wild and wacky characters!
